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
323987 515670146 82596 711
771782 7474880290 88451057
771782 7474880290 88451057
31106827876 18 691
All about undefined
Interested in learning more?
771782 7474880290 88451057
31106827876 18 691
See more
25534023 579856567 78612147470
04417985 781052518 1647033 446
See more
72791746 57 779
5985691 7330 507340
See more